Gwacheon, just south of Seoul. We are a small community established in a lovely natural setting on a hillside with trees, flowers, gardens, a nature trail, and beautiful views of Gwanak Mountain. We have a diverse student body with fantastic parental and community support. WCA follows a Canadian curriculum and is accredited by the Middle States Association Commission on Elementary and Secondary Schools (MSA-CESS), the National Council for Private School Accreditation (NCPSA) and Accreditation International (Ai).

We are seeking a middle/high school science teacher to join us for the 2023-24 academic year, beginning late August 2023. The teacher is responsible for teaching the following classes:

- General Science 9
- General Science 10
- Biology 11
- Biology OR Chemistry OR Physics 12
- an additional class or mentor position TBD

We offer small class sizes, paid vacations, and a competitive salary based on experience. The ideal candidate holds an F-class visa (or is a Korean national), has teaching experience, and is a certified educator (or is enrolled in a certification program).



Working Conditions:

- Working hours: Monday to Friday from 8:15AM to 4:00PM

- Staff Meetings: usually two Wednesdays each month, from 3:40 to 4:40PM

- Supervision: one or two lunch recesses during the week



Benefits:

- Salary ranges from KRW 2.4-3.8 million depending on experience, degrees, and teaching license/credential

- Paid winter, spring, and summer vacation (12 weeks per year)

- No sports coaching or after-school programs, no mandatory winter or summer camps, no weekends

- Organically-based lunches (provided free of charge at the school's cafeteria)

- Tuition waiver for children

- Small class sizes (less than 15)

- Medical insurance, severance, pension

- Teaching contracts can be renewed for additional years of employment

- Key money loan of up to KRW 10 million to secure housing
